Corn Halwa Recipe - Makki Ka Halwa

Total Time: 25 minutes

Cuisine: Indian

Ingredients:

  • saffron strands generous
  • ghee
  • cardamom (elaichi) podsseeds
  • milk
  • sugar
  • sweet corn
  • cashews

Instructions:

  • To begin making the Corn Halwa recipe, firstly boil or pressure cook sweet corn in 2 tablespoons of water for 2 whistles
  • Allow it to cool
  • Add the cooked corn kernels to mixer and grind into coarse paste adding a little water
  • Heat 2 tablespoons ghee in a heavy bottomed pan
  • Add the corn paste and saute well for 5 minutes until the colour changes to golden
  • Now add milk, sugar, saffron and crushed cardamom to it
  • Stir well and cook the Corn Halwa in medium flame until it becomes slightly thick
  • Add the remaining ghee and cook the Corn Halwa stirring continuously until the ghee gets absorbed and starts leaving sides of the pan
  • This will take about 6 to 8 minutes
  • Heat a tadka pan with ghee
  • Add the cashews and fry till they turn a little brown in colour
  • Add these cashews with ghee on the Corn Halwa and it is ready to be served
